WebWith the addition of a Stratum 3 clock module to the SCBE, an MX240, MX480, or MX960 chassis can perform clock monitoring, filtering, and holdover in a centralized chassis location. Chassis line cards can be configured to recover network timing clocks at the physical layer via Synchronous Ethernet or by a packet-based PTP implementation. BITS Clock Flexibility Building Integrated Timing Supply (BITS) is a synchronous Time Division Multiplexing (TDM) signal, used to synchronize communication systems and data networks. This type of signal is a highly reliable and stable source for propagating frequency over wide transmission networks.
